Understanding quantity is essential for 4-year-olds as it lays the foundation for their future mathematical and cognitive development. At this age, children's brains are highly malleable, making it an ideal time to introduce fundamental concepts related to numbers and measurements.
When parents and teachers emphasize the understanding of quantity, children learn to distinguish between more and less, to count objects, and to comprehend basic mathematical concepts such as addition and subtraction. These early experiences foster critical thinking and problem-solving skills, essential for academic success.
Moreover, understanding quantity plays a significant role outside the classroom. It helps children navigate daily life by enhancing their ability to compare objects, recognize patterns, and understand the world around them. This foundational knowledge also boosts self-confidence as they solve problems and engage in conversations about numbers.
Additionally, incorporating fun and interactive activities, such as counting games or measuring ingredients in cooking, makes learning engaging and enjoyable. This approach encourages a love for learning that can last a lifetime. In short, when parents and teachers prioritize understanding quantity, they equip children with vital skills that will serve them well throughout their education and everyday experiences.
